Hello everyone I have been debating on which fronts. I have the 16/8 GTA rims zero offsets. I have the M&H 275/55/16's for the rears but debating to get 225/60/16?? or 245/50/16?? for the front, want something to match and look good with no rubbing issues if any can chime in.
 
245/50 is probably the best bet, but some tires like the BFG G-Force are larger than others in that size and will rub slightly at full lock. 225/50 shouldn't rub at all but will look small compared to the rear M&H's. Never heard of anyone using a 60 series tire on a 16 on these cars and I imagine being an inch taller would rub like hell up front.
 
I have currently 235 60 15 and no problems rubbing but I guess 16inch would make a difference
 
Tman75 I run 245/50 on BFG G-Force Comp -2 A/S, Lot of members run BFG G-Force sport,and split the sizes an run 255/50. I have no problem with rubbing
by running all 245/50 . but the 87 G/N set about inch higher than a 86 GN.
 
Here's my car as an example. GTA fronts, BFG G-Force Sport Comp 2's, 245/50 front and 255/50 rear. Car is lowered about an inch - inch and a half.
